Solution

The correct option is A

5 → 2


Explanation for the Correct Option:

Option (A):

  • As per the given question, the lines falls in the visible spectrum.
  • Hence it is suggested that the transition would be possible from the Balmer series.
  • Thus for the third line, the transition states would be n1=2 and n2=5.
  • Hence, this suggests the transition is from 5 → 2.

Hence, the third line from the red end corresponds to inter-orbit jumps of the electron from 5 → 2.
